A cool match performed by the forward “set fire” to the butts of the rabid Canadiens fans.

Washington Capitals hockey player Alexander Ovechkin pleased Russian fans with four points in one match for the first time in three years by skating around Montreal. But the Canadian fans, who can’t wait for our forward to retire, are not laughing now.

“Very important two points”

Montreal is one of the most convenient teams for Ovechkin. In the away game of the current regular season, the Russian forward confirmed this, scoring three goals and making one assist. Alexander’s contribution to this success of “Washington” is difficult to overestimate, because he had a hand in exactly half of the goals. It is not known how this meeting would have turned out, because the Capitals won with a difference of four goals – 8:4.

The hockey community has not seen such performance from Ovechkin since 2022, when the Russian left no stone unturned against the Chicago defense. Thanks to Alexander’s performance in the match with the Canadian club, Washington moved up to the playoff zone. The Russian rewrote many cool records, and also entered the top 10 best scorers in the history of the NHL.

At the same time, after a fantastic game, the Russian modestly focused on the team’s successes and partners. Alexander also did not miss the opportunity to congratulate teammate Dylan Strome on the birth of his third child.

– This is a very important match, very important two points. I think this is an important day for him and his family. This is very cool. I’m glad that Ethan Frank and Sonny Milano took the opportunity and showed that we can replace the injured guys. “They work hard and have made a big contribution to today’s success,” the NHL’s official website quotes Ovechkin as saying.

The Ukrainian hockey championship match took place between Storm and Odeshchina. The meeting ended with a score of 8:3 in Storm’s favor.

It should also be said that the team, which had major problems in its squad and regularly played with 12-13 hockey players, received important reinforcements from Dnepr. Five new artists appeared in the application of Odessa residents and brought immediate results.

Newcomers Laktionov, Chupryna and Deliy scored two points each.

The teams have 17 points and share 3-4 places.

Traditionally, one of the most interesting hockey tournaments of the year begins – the U-20 World Junior Championship in the elite league. The tournament will take place in the USA from December 26 to January 5.

The American team will defend the title it won in Canada a year ago. However, Maple will try to heal herself after the failure.

The teams are divided into two groups of 5 teams, the top 4 will advance to the play-offs and the last two will compete for survival among the elite.

Group A: USA, Sweden, Slovakia, Switzerland, Germany

Group B: Finland, Czech Republic, Canada, Latvia, Denmark
